Tanzanian Royalty Exploration is an average overall performer. With a 'C' rating of 44.1 for overall impact (30th percentile compared to all companies), Tanzanian Royalty Exploration ranks 73rd out of 102 industry peers, behind Osisko Gold Royalties, Kinross Gold, Anglogold Ashanti and 69 others, and ahead of Ramelius Resources, Emerald Resources, Barrick Gold and 26 others. On top material causes for Tanzanian Royalty Exploration's industry (Metals & Mining), Tanzanian Royalty Exploration performs well in Fair Labor Practices (89.7 score) and Safety From Violent Conflict (95.4) and performs poorly in Reduced Green House Gas Emissions (0.0 score), Terrestrial Biodiversity (36.4), Sustainable Use of Water (29.5) and 3 other causes where it received a 'D' or 'F' score.

TRX Gold Corporation, a junior gold mining company, engages in the exploration, development, and production of mineral property in Tanzania. Its flagship project includes the Buckreef Gold Project in Tanzania. The company was formerly known as Tanzanian Gold Corporation and changed its name to TRX Gold Corporation in May 2022. The company was incorporated in 1990 and is based in Oakville, Canada.
